– What’s The Difference Between Concrete Lifting With Mud And Foam?
Concrete lifting and leveling is another name for developing a concrete base with mud. The slurry is the resultant sand, cement, and other substances used in this process.
In comparison, concrete lifting with foam or poly jacking uses a high-strength geo-technical expanding foam to raise and stabilize concrete slabs. The only distinction is the foam utilized for concrete lifting is significantly more robust.

– What Causes Concrete To Become Unleveled?
Concrete that sinks or sags due to dampness is the most frequent cause. When the subsoil beneath the concrete gets wet and dries, it compacts the soil and creates voids that allow the concrete to settle.
